#Occupationaltherapy stops becoming “occupational” when it only improves body function, doesnt consider contexts, doesnt collaborate with other professionals, when diagnosis overpowers patient stories, lived experience isnt integrated in EBP, and #occupations are secondary.

My scientific dilemma with “evidence-based practice” is how it deprioritises practising based on patient and caregiver stories, culture, values, and the tacit observations of daily living.
